// Visual capture for screenshots and image comparison #pragma once #include #include #include namespace mosis::testing { // PNG image data struct ImageData { uint32_t width = 0; uint32_t height = 0; std::vector pixels; // RGBA format bool IsValid() const { return width > 0 && height > 0 && !pixels.empty(); } }; // Result of image comparison struct CompareResult { bool match = false; double diff_percent = 0.0; uint32_t diff_pixels = 0; ImageData diff_image; }; // Captures and compares screenshots class VisualCapture { public: VisualCapture() = default; // Capture current framebuffer to image ImageData CaptureFramebuffer(uint32_t width, uint32_t height) const; // Save image to PNG file bool SavePNG(const ImageData& image, const std::string& path) const; // Load PNG file to image ImageData LoadPNG(const std::string& path) const; // Compare two images CompareResult Compare(const ImageData& actual, const ImageData& expected, double threshold = 0.01) const; // Generate diff image (highlights differences) ImageData GenerateDiff(const ImageData& actual, const ImageData& expected) const; // Utility: flip image vertically (for OpenGL coordinate conversion) void FlipVertically(ImageData& image) const; }; } // namespace mosis::testing
